Experimental Characterization of the Optical Loss of Sapphire-Bonded Photonic Crystal Laser Cavities
Abstract
Sapphire-bonded photonic crystal laser cavities with varying number of photonic crystal periods were studied in order to determine the optical loss in these cavities. The lasing threshold increases as the number of lattice periods decreases, and the quality factors of these cavities were calculated from the lasing threshold data. Continuous-wave operation was achieved for cavities with eight or more cladding periods
